Abstract

The utility model discloses a steel wire rope rust removing device, which comprises a barrel body rotatably arranged on a base, wherein through holes are respectively formed at two ends of the barrel body, a lead pipe is respectively arranged in the through holes, so that the lead pipe can displace along the axial direction of the barrel body, a butt joint ring is arranged at one end of the lead pipe, which is positioned in the barrel body, a limit ring is arranged at one end of the lead pipe, which is positioned outside the barrel body, and a clamp assembly is arranged at the outer side surface of the barrel body, so that the clamp assembly can lock the lead pipe on the barrel body; the steel wire brushing device solves the problem that in the prior art, the steel wire rope is difficult to penetrate the rotating mechanism due to insufficient hardness in the actual operation process.

Steel wire rope rust removing device
Technical Field
The utility model relates to the field of steel wire rope processing, in particular to a steel wire rope rust removing device.
Background
The steel wire rope is easy to rust after long-term storage, and needs to be subjected to rust removal operation. For example, chinese patent No. CN201910582056.5 provides a steel wire brushing device, which comprises a frame and a motor arranged at the lower part of the frame, a rotating mechanism is arranged at the upper part of the frame, the rotating mechanism is in a cylindrical structure, two bearings are respectively installed near two ends of the rotating mechanism, a belt pulley is arranged at the middle position of the rotating mechanism, the bearings are fixed on the frame through a pressing plate, the belt pulley is connected with the motor through a belt, a cavity is arranged inside the rotating mechanism, impellers distributed circumferentially are arranged in the cavity, silicon carbide is filled in the cavity, and material holes are formed at two ends of the rotating mechanism. Such as the above-mentioned prior art wire brushing device, it is difficult to thread the rotating mechanism during actual operation due to insufficient hardness of the wire rope.
Disclosure of Invention
The utility model aims to provide a steel wire rope rust removing device, which solves the problem that in the prior art, a steel wire brush device is difficult to penetrate a rotating mechanism due to insufficient hardness of a steel wire rope in the actual operation process.
In order to achieve the above object, the utility model provides a steel wire rope rust removing device, which comprises a cylinder body rotatably arranged on a base, wherein through holes are respectively formed at two ends of the cylinder body, a lead pipe is respectively arranged in the through holes, so that the lead pipe can displace along the axial direction of the cylinder body, a butt joint ring is arranged at one end, positioned in the cylinder body, of the lead pipe, a limit ring is arranged at one end, positioned outside the cylinder body, of the lead pipe, and a clamp assembly is arranged at the outer side surface of the cylinder body, so that the clamp assembly can lock the lead pipe on the cylinder body.
Preferably, the clamp assembly is composed of two arc-shaped clamps, one end of each arc-shaped clamp is hinged to the cylinder body, and the other end of each arc-shaped clamp is connected through a screw assembly.
Preferably, the inner wall of the cylinder is provided with an agitating plate.
Preferably, an opening is formed in the circumferential side surface of the cylinder, a cover plate is arranged on the opening, and the cover plate is locked on the cylinder through a lock catch.
Preferably, the two ends of the cylinder body are provided with rotating rings, the base is provided with a bracket, the bracket is provided with a bearing, and the rotating rings are arranged in the bearing.
Preferably, a motor is arranged on the base, an output shaft of the motor is connected with a first belt wheel, a second belt wheel is coaxially arranged on the rotating ring, and the first belt wheel is connected with the second belt wheel through a belt.
The utility model provides a steel wire rope rust removing device, which comprises a barrel body rotatably arranged on a base, wherein through holes are respectively formed at two ends of the barrel body, a lead pipe is respectively arranged in the through holes, so that the lead pipe can displace along the axial direction of the barrel body, a butt joint ring is arranged at one end of the lead pipe, which is positioned in the barrel body, a limit ring is arranged at one end of the lead pipe, which is positioned outside the barrel body, and a clamp assembly is arranged at the outer side surface of the barrel body, so that the clamp assembly can lock the lead pipe on the barrel body;
the beneficial effects are that: when the operation, remove the lead tube at barrel both ends for it is inside the butt joint at the barrel, inserts wire rope from the one end of lead tube, and draw forth from the other end, later resets the lead tube, makes the butt joint ring contradict with the inner wall of barrel, utilizes the clamp subassembly to lock the lead tube, rotates the barrel, makes inside dull polish and wire rope contact reach the purpose of rust cleaning. Compared with the prior art, the steel wire rope rust removing device provided by the utility model is convenient for threading the steel wire rope.

Description of the reference numerals
1-a base; 2-a bracket; 3-an electric motor; 4-a first pulley; 5-a belt; 6-a second pulley; 7-cover plate; 8-locking; 9-a cylinder; 10-a lead tube; 11-a rotating ring; 12-limiting rings; 13-an agitation plate; 14-a docking ring; 15-clamp assembly.
Detailed Description
The following describes specific embodiments of the present utility model in detail with reference to the drawings. It should be understood that the detailed description and specific examples, while indicating and illustrating the utility model, are not intended to limit the utility model.
As shown in fig. 1-3, the utility model provides a steel wire rope rust removing device, which comprises a cylinder 9 rotatably arranged on a base 1, wherein through holes are respectively formed at two ends of the cylinder 9, a lead tube 10 is respectively arranged in the through holes, so that the lead tube 10 can displace along the axial direction of the cylinder 9, a butt joint ring 14 is arranged at one end of the lead tube 10, which is positioned in the cylinder 9, a limiting ring 12 is arranged at one end of the lead tube 10, which is positioned outside the cylinder 9, and a clamp assembly 15 is arranged at the outer side surface of the cylinder 9, so that the clamp assembly 15 can lock the lead tube 10 on the cylinder 9. When the operation, remove the lead tube at barrel both ends for it is inside the butt joint at the barrel, inserts wire rope from the one end of lead tube, and draw forth from the other end, later resets the lead tube, makes the butt joint ring contradict with the inner wall of barrel, utilizes the clamp subassembly to lock the lead tube, rotates the barrel, makes inside dull polish and wire rope contact reach the purpose of rust cleaning. Compared with the prior art, the steel wire rope rust removing device provided by the utility model is convenient for threading the steel wire rope.
In a preferred embodiment of the present utility model, in order to avoid displacement of the guide tube 10 when it rotates with the cylinder 9, the clip assembly 15 is composed of two arc clips, one end of which is hinged to the cylinder 9, and the other end of which is connected by a screw assembly.
In a preferred embodiment of the present utility model, in order to facilitate the sanding of the interior of the barrel, the inner wall of the barrel 9 is provided with a stirring plate 13.
In a preferred embodiment of the present utility model, in order to facilitate replacement of the frosted inside, an opening is formed on the circumferential side of the cylinder 9, and a cover plate 7 is disposed on the opening, and the cover plate 7 is locked on the cylinder 9 through a lock catch 8.
In a preferred embodiment of the present utility model, in order to support the cylinder 9 and facilitate rotation of the cylinder 9, two ends of the cylinder 9 are formed with rotating rings 11, the base 1 is provided with a bracket 2, the bracket 2 is provided with a bearing, and the rotating rings 11 are disposed in the bearing.
In a preferred embodiment of the present utility model, in order to drive the cylinder 9 to rotate, the base 1 is provided with a motor 3, an output shaft of the motor 3 is connected with a first belt pulley 4, the rotating ring 11 is coaxially provided with a second belt pulley 6, and the first belt pulley 4 and the second belt pulley 6 are connected through a belt 5.
